Mojave desert located in the southwestern united states has a hot, dry climate.

<h3>What is renowned about the Mojave Desert?</h3>

The Mojave Desert is well-known for having the lowest elevation in North America, the hottest air and surface temperatures ever recorded on Earth. On July 10th, 1913, Furnace Creek in Death Valley recorded a temperature of 134 F (56.7 C).

<h3>Where is the Mojave Desert located?</h3>

Four states border the Mojave Desert: California, Nevada, Utah, and Arizona.

Texture is not one of the five criteria listed for the strict definition of a mineral.

Explanation:

A mineral is generally defined as a naturally occurring solid chemical compound which is present in its pure from. A substance is said to be a mineral, if it satisfies the following five criteria: <u>naturally occurring, solid, inorganic, ordered internal structure, definite chemical composition.</u>

Therefore, a mineral is a naturally occurring solid inorganic substance with a well-defined chemical composition and specific crystalline structure.

<u>Therefore, we can say that</u><u> texture</u><u> is not one of the criteria that defines a mineral.</u>
